The affordability of prefab homes stems from several key factors inherent in their manufacturing process. Unlike traditional construction, which often incurs high labor costs due to extended on-site work, weather delays, and material waste, prefab homes are produced in controlled factory environments. This setting allows for standardized production processes, bulk material purchasing, and efficient workflow management, all of which significantly lower per-unit costs. Factory workers can specialize in specific tasks, increasing productivity and reducing the likelihood of errors that would otherwise lead to costly rework. Additionally, the ability to produce multiple home modules simultaneously reduces overall production time, translating to lower labor expenses and faster project completion, which further contributes to cost savings. Material efficiency is another critical component of affordable prefab homes. In factory settings, materials are measured, cut, and utilized with precision, minimizing waste. Traditional construction often results in significant material loss due to on-site cutting errors, weather damage, or over-ordering, but prefab manufacturing optimizes material usage through advanced planning and computer-aided design (CAD) systems. This not only reduces material costs but also aligns with sustainable practices, making prefab homes an eco-friendly choice that appeals to budget-conscious buyers concerned about environmental impact. Affordable prefab homes also benefit from economies of scale. Manufacturers producing prefab homes in large quantities can negotiate better prices with material suppliers, passing these savings on to customers. This bulk purchasing power extends to fixtures, appliances, and building components, ensuring that even high-quality materials and finishes remain within reach for affordable housing projects. Furthermore, the modular nature of prefab homes allows for flexible design options, enabling buyers to choose configurations that fit their budget without sacrificing essential features. For example, smaller module sizes or simplified interior finishes can reduce costs, while still providing a safe, functional living space. Beyond production costs, affordable prefab homes offer long-term financial benefits to homeowners. Their energy-efficient design, often incorporating insulation, energy-saving windows, and sustainable heating and cooling systems, reduces monthly utility expenses. Many prefab homes are also built with durable materials such as aluminum and stainless steel, which require less maintenance and have longer lifespans compared to traditional construction materials, lowering long-term repair and replacement costs. These factors contribute to overall affordability by reducing the total cost of homeownership over time.
